Summary
BLACK CONSTRUCTION CORPORATION has accumulated 14 OSHA violations across 26 inspections over 27 years of recorded history, with $7,490 in total assessed penalties.
The establishment sits in the 93rd percentile for violations within its industry-state peer group of 837 employers. Inspection frequency runs at the 99th percentile. The most recent enforcement activity was recorded 3 years ago.
